Analysis

The most recent figure for tomatoes — area harvested, per unit of gdp in Malta is 0 ha per US$ of GDP, measured in 2017. That is the lowest value across all 48 years on record.

That represents a change of down 25.2% on the previous year and down 58.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, tomatoes — area harvested, per unit of gdp in Malta peaked at 0 ha per US$ of GDP in 1970 and was at its lowest, 0 ha per US$ of GDP, in 2017.

That places Malta 87th out of 148 countries with data for 2017,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Tomatoes — Area harvested div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Tomatoes — Area harvested ÷ GDP (current US$)
